我在ubuntu上建立了一个单节点hadoop集群,在我的机器上安装了hadoop2.6版本。问题:每次我创建配置单元表并将数据加载到其中时,我都可以通过查询来查看数据,但是一旦我关闭hadoop,表就会消失。我有没有办法留住他们,或者我缺少什么设置?我尝试了一些网上提供的解决方案,但没有工作,请帮助我与这个。块引用谢谢b
vatpfxk51#
配置单元表数据在hadoop hdfs上,配置单元只需添加一个 meta data 并为用户提供类似sql的命令,以防止他们编写基本的mr作业。因此,如果关闭hadoop集群,hive将无法在表中找到数据。但如果你说当你 restart 在hadoop集群中,数据丢失了。这是另一个问题。
meta data
restart
bxfogqkk2#
似乎您正在使用默认derby作为元存储。请配置配置单元元存储。我正在指向链接。请将其搁置。配置单元未显示表
2条答案
按热度按时间vatpfxk51#
配置单元表数据在hadoop hdfs上,配置单元只需添加一个
meta data
并为用户提供类似sql的命令,以防止他们编写基本的mr作业。因此,如果关闭hadoop集群,hive将无法在表中找到数据。但如果你说当你
restart
在hadoop集群中,数据丢失了。这是另一个问题。bxfogqkk2#
似乎您正在使用默认derby作为元存储。请配置配置单元元存储。我正在指向链接。请将其搁置。配置单元未显示表